Peach Amaretto Crumbles

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ons oat flour, use certified gf oat flour, if necessary, 12 grams
  • 3 tablespoons rolled oats, use certified gf rolled oats, if necessary, 16 grams
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ons coconut sugar, or brown sugar, 17 grams
  • pinch of salt
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ted, 21 grams
  • 2 tablespoons amaretto
  • 1 tablespoon honey, 20 grams
  • 1/4 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• pinch of salt
  • 1/2 tablespoon cornstarch
  • 1 1/2 cups chopped and peeled peaches, 270 grams

Details

Servings 2
Preparation time 15mins
Cooking time 45mins
Adapted from foodfanatic.com

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 350 °F (175 °C) and grease 2 one-cup ramekins.

Mix all the topping ingredients together in a small bowl and set aside.

In a medium mixing bowl, mix together the first five filling ingredients. Add the peaches and mix until the peaches are well coated in the mixture.

Divide the peach mixture evenly between the 2 ramekins and distribute the topping evenly over the peaches.

Place the crumbles on a baking sheet (to catch any unlikely spills) and bake for 25-30 minutes or until the topping is firm and the peaches are bubbly around the edges. Let cool for 10 minutes and serve warm,

room temperature, or cold. If you have any left over, cover and refrigerate for up to 3 days.
